Just like humans, canines could have sleep-floor preferences. A too-soft mattress could not offer enough help. And canine with heart circumstances corresponding to mitral valve disease might find a bed uncomfortable as properly.

I’ve heard from some of my clients with Cavalier King Charles Spaniels that because the disease progresses, their dogs prefer to sleep on a hard and/or cool floor corresponding to the ground. Whatever the reason for sleep loss, analysis has shown that it takes a toll on us each mentally and bodily. While we sleep, our our bodies secrete hormones that affect our mood, energy, memory, and concentration. Testing has shown that with a driving simulator or a hand-eye coordination task, sleep deprived individuals could carry out just as badly as intoxicated individuals. Finally, your dog may not need to choose one human’s bed over one other — some canine, I think, are too truthful to play favorites. Sleeping in a single individual’s mattress would imply slighting one other family member, so as a substitute they sleep within the corridor to allow them to keep an eye on everybody. Other canines will keep away from the mattress — unless one thing is wrong. My team member Christie Keith, who has sighthounds, says she has had two Scottish Deerhounds who by no means appreciated to get on the bed. Interestingly, although, each of them would get on the mattress after they weren’t feeling nicely. “It was usually one of many indicators that something was critically wrong,” she says.
